Request for Proposals - Aviation Pump Station

TOWN OF CARY
Cary, North Carolina

The Town of Cary is soliciting statements of qualifications and proposals from qualified consulting engineering firms to design a new pump station bar screen, screenings conveyance system, odor control, and all ancillary improvements required for installation at the Aviation (Morrisville Public Works) wastewater pumping station and for the installation of a grinder/comminutor system, odor control, and all ancillary improvements required for installation at the Perimeter Park wastewater pumping station. These two pump stations are located in Morrisville and are part of the Town of Cary wastewater collection system

An option of the Town will be for the consultant to provide construction administration services for the construction of the design improvements.

Proposals will be received at the Town of Cary Public Works and Utilities Department, William H. Garmon Operations Center, 400 James Jackson Avenue, Cary, North Carolina, 27513 until 3 p.m. on Friday, August 20, 2010.
